The aim of this paper is to present the design, implementation and evaluation of the methodology which focuses on the pedagogical utilization of Interactive Videoconferencing (IVC) in the contemporary elementary school. As part of the project “ODYSSEAS”, during the school year 2010 – 2011, 152 students and 13 teachers from four elementary schools in Athens, Aigina and Chania collaborated at distance via IVC and, with the aid of the animation technique and distance learning material, designed and implemented constructive activities on the topic: “Environment – Mediterranean Sea -Renewable Energy Sources. Major contributors for the development of the program “ODYSSEUS’ are the Department of Education in the University of Crete ( http://www.edc.uoc.gr/~odysseas/ ).
